Shonda Rhimes Developing Comedy Based On Luvvie Ajayi’s “I’m Judging You”
Ajayi published her first book, I’m Judging You: The Do-Better Manual, with Henry Holt & Co in September 2016, and debuted at number five on the New York Times best-seller list. Ajayi has said the inspiration for the book came after she learned a journalist had plagiarized several paragraphs of her writing—and when confronted, he said he was unaware he should have credited her work. Consequently,
a return to ethics—a return to a higher level of behavior for oneself and others—becomes the central idea of Ajayi’s book.
No additional details about the series have yet been released. Congrats to her!
